What you’ll be doing as a Senior Quality Engineer

Execute Quality Engineering techniques, using judgement and ingenuity in making adaptations and modifications, applying Quality Management Systems, PowerBI and various other analytics software.

  • Work directly with Bell Centers of Excellence (COE) and suppliers to establish and maintain a system for Statistical Process Controls focusing on process monitoring and preventative actions.

  • Work directly with engineering for review of design drawings and models before release to ensure quality, inspectability, customer and QMS system requirements are present.

  • Present program quality system health and monitoring to internal and external customers.

  • Facilitate, review, approve, monitor, and advise on quality planning (FMEA, PFMEA, control plans, first article, inspection planning, and corrective and preventative actions, as required)

  • Coordinate and interact with engineering on requirement definition for purposes of inspectability and producibility.

  • Assist and perform Measurement Systems Analysis at COE and at Suppliers. Provide training to personnel or facilitate as required.

  • Generate Quality requirements for product utilizing advanced quality tools.

  • Facilitate and monitor Root Cause/Corrective Action investigations.

  • Facilitating Corrective Action Boards (CAB) as required

  • Research and help develop and test new inspection technologies.

  • Interaction with customers (DCMA, AMCOM, SRD)

  • Conduct, monitor and manage material containment and data analysis for areas of responsibility.

  • Develop and implement operations intelligence into the manufacturing floor.

  • Perform QMS/AS9100 System audits and process reviews.
